This walking tour of São Paulo's historic center offers an in-depth look at the city's architectural gems and cultural highlights. Begin at the Pateo do Collegio, the birthplace of São Paulo, and journey through centuries of history with stops at the Manor of the Marquesa of Santos and the majestic Catedral da Sé. Marvel at the neoclassical beauty of the Centro Cultural Banco do Brasil and experience the grandeur of the Martinelli Building, Latin America's first skyscraper. Conclude your tour with a visit to the Theatro Municipal, a symbol of São Paulo's cultural evolution. Pateo do Collegio
Discover the historic founding site and museum, where Jesuits established the first school, laying the foundation for São Paulo's growth into the largest city in the Southern Hemisphere.
Manor Of The Marquesa Of Santos
Explore the residence of Domitila de Castro Canto, an influential figure in São Paulo's history, and learn about her significant contributions to the city's development.
Catedral da Se de Sao Paulo
Visit the grand Sé Cathedral, inspired by medieval European churches, marking the center of São Paulo and offering a glimpse into its religious and cultural heritage.
Centro Cultural Banco do Brasil
Experience the neoclassical architecture of this cultural hub, featuring a cinema, theater, and exhibitions in a building dating back to 1901.
Edificio Martinelli
Ascend to the rooftop observation deck of Latin America's first skyscraper and enjoy panoramic views of the city while learning about its controversial construction.
